Job description

Key Responsibilities:

  • Planned and delivered learning activities under the guidance of teaching staff, including whole-class cover.

  • Supported pupils with Special Educational Needs (SEN), including those with autism, ADHD, and complex communication needs.

  • Led small group interventions in literacy and numeracy, as well as 1:1 support for targeted learners.

  • Assisted in the development of Individual Education Plans (IEPs) and behavioural support strategies.

  • Worked collaboratively with teaching staff and external professionals to adapt curriculum materials and create inclusive learning environments.

  • Provided pastoral support, promoting positive behaviour and emotional well-being.

  • Monitored pupil progress and maintained accurate records to support assessment and reporting.

  • Supervised pupils during breaks, outings, and extra-curricular activities.
